SPECIAL ABILITIES

Divine Performance (6 rnds./day) (Su)

The Cantor is trained to use Perform (wind instrument) to create magical effects on those around him, including himself if desired. Each round, the Cantor can produce any one of the types of divine performance listed below.

Starting a divine performance is a standard action, but it can be maintained each round as a free action. Changing a divine performance from one effect to another requires the cantor to stop the previous performance and start a new one as a standard action. A divine performance cannot be disrupted, but it ends immediately if the cantor is killed, paralyzed, stunned, knocked unconscious, or otherwise prevented from taking a free action to maintain it each round.

All divine performances affect only targets or areas the sound reaches, although creatures need not hear it to be affected unless noted by the performance. Many performances are language-dependent (as noted in the description). Deaf creatures are immune to divine performances with audible components.

Drowsing Lullaby (Divine Performance) (Su)

The Cantor’s song fogs foes’ minds. Enemies that can hear the performance and are within 30 feet suffer a –1 penalty on attack rolls and saving throws unless they succeed at a DC 12 Will save. Creatures that successfully save are immune to the Cantor’s drowsing lullaby for 24 hours. This is a mind-affecting effect.

Harmony of Fate (Su)

Once during his divine performance, without using an action, the Cantor can glimpse a moment into the future and change his decisions to alter the outcome. When he rolls an attack roll or saving throw, but before learning the outcome, he can decide to roll again.

The Cantor must keep the new result even if it is worse than the old one. The Cantor may use this ability once per hour.

Healing Melody: Once per day, while maintaining a divine performance, the Cantor may spend a swift action to sing a melody that reinvigorates the soul, restoring 1 hit point to an ally within 30 feet.

Refreshing Refrain (Hymn Verse) (Su)

The touched target is healed of 1 hit point per Hit Die it possesses and heals 1 point of ability damage, as if from a night’s rest. The target of refreshing refrain can attempt a new saving throw against one ongoing affliction, ignoring any effect from failure.
